Well what can I say. I have been a Kaszazz Consultant for nearly 5years, coming up in October. Every year since I have joined I have made these cards for christmas. They are so easy and so versatile, I don't think they will ever age, they are called Flourish Christmas Cards and were designed by Jo Collingwood. Lots of stamping using Time Holtz Distress Inks, Fired Brick and Pine Needles. Stamps used on the cards are Fancy Flourish, Merry Christmas Bold, Mini Messages - Christmas Un-Cut Set (10), Noel (which I love), and Pine Tree Flourish Large. I hope you enjoy these cards.
